top
Loading...
Phorum安裝指南

Phorum 安裝指南

1. 安裝php,推薦使用3.0.12及以上版本的php,但Phorum也可以在3.0.6下工作,但卻有一些問題.
Phorum已在3.0.12和4 beta 3下測試.

2. 安裝數據庫.
Mysql 版本 3.22.x或更高版本. (www.tcx.se)
PostgreSQL 6.4.1或更高版本.(www.postgresql.org)

3. 如果你還沒有一個數據庫,使用"mysqladmin"創建一個:

mysqladmin -uuser -ppassword create mydb
使用root用戶(空密碼): mysqladmin create mydb

也可以使用mysql:

mysql>create database mydb;

4. 確定此用戶對數據庫擁有select,insert,update,delete,create,alter 和 drop的權力.
一個MySQL 對此用戶的授權聲明可以像這樣:

GRANT
select, insert, update, create, alter, delete, drop
ON
database.*
TO
user@localhost
IDENTIFIED BY
'password';

如果你直接使用root用戶,就不需要進行步驟4.

5. 創建表. 使用db目錄中的*.sql 來完成此工作. 例如:在MYSQL中,你可以這樣:

> mysql -uuser -ppassword dbname < mysql.sql
使用root用戶(空密碼): mysql dbname < mysql.sql

例如: mysql mydb < drive:pathmysql.sql

6. 修改 common.php. (如無必要,可不修改,直接跳過此步)

a)修改 $inf_path 指向你放forums.php的目錄.
b)修改 $include_path 指向你放included文件的目錄.
c)修改 $admindir 指向你放admin文件的目錄.
e)設置主要管理腳本的名字($admin_page) (缺省是index.php).
f)配置Phorum和你的DBMS的接口. 修改這行:

require './db/{yourdbms}.php';

例子: require './db/mysql.php';

從db目錄中找到你需要的文件.

POSTGRESQL 用戶注意: 如果你使用PostgreSQL 6.5或更新的版本,使用
postgresql65.php文件. 其他的使用postgresql.php文件.

7. 使webserver對admin/forums目錄有寫的權力 (只對Unix及Linux用戶)

> cd admin
> chmod 707 forums

8. 使webserver對配置文件有寫的權力 (只對Unix及Linux用戶)

> cd [inf_path]
> chmod 707 forums.php
> chmod 706 forums.bak.php

9. 將文件轉到web服務器上. 將存放phorum的目錄虛擬成web虛擬目錄phorum.

注意:如果你是第一次安裝,你需要對這些文件更名:

forums.php-dist => forums.php
forums.bak.php-dist => forums.bak.php
header.php-dist => header.php
footer.php-dist => footer.php

10. 進入Admin管理頁面,使用http://localhost/phorum/admin/index.php

選擇phorum setup,再選擇database settings,設定好數據庫的連接參數

也可以通過修改phorums.php來完成:

// initialize database variables初始化數據庫變量
$dbName='mydb';// 設定數據庫名
$dbUser='root';// 設定用戶
$dbPass='';// 設定用戶密碼
$dbServer='localhost';//設定數據庫服務器

11. 選擇main回到主頁面,選擇"new forum"來創建一個forum

12. ok,可以使用了

作者:http://www.zhujiangroad.com
來源:http://www.zhujiangroad.com
北斗有巢氏 有巢氏北斗